Thermoplane has a significantly higher thermal conductivity than sand cement screeds and timber, coupled with its self compacting ability which eliminates air entrapment and thinner overall screed depth, (Minimum 25mm nominal 30mm cover to the pipes) leads to a more energy efficient and responsive screed.

When the aerated concrete is produced by a mixture of cement and very fine sand, the density of the usual mixes varies from 500 to 1100 kg/m 3. In the case of other light weight concretes, the strength of aerated concrete varies with the density. The thermal conductivity of aerated concrete also varies with its density.

Aggregate Blocks; Aggregate Blocks. Aggregate blocks cover a wide spectrum of solid, cellular (void does not go fully through block) and hollow blocks with densities from 650 to 2400 kg/m 3 and range of compressive strengths: Solid blocks from 2.9 to 40N/mm 2 and cellular/hollow 2.9 to 22.5M/mm 2.
